Description
Style: Mid-century Japanese kitsch "Big Eye" aesthetic.
Design: Reclining girl with oversized blue eyes, holding a small blue floral candle cup.
Material: Hand-painted bisque ceramic
Origin: Made in Japan (retains original gold foil sticker on the base).
Condition: Vintage; no chips or cracks.
This figurine is a prime example of the 1960s "Big Eye" art movement, popularized by artists like Margaret Keane and exported worldwide through Japanese novelty ceramics. These pieces were often sold in boutique gift shops and were highly collectible "shelf sitters" of the era.
